I am printing to a local Brother 1440 printer and whenever
I click to print I get the message "There is not enough
space on your PC. Make room on the hard disk by deleting
some files." I have more than enough room - brand new
laptop - compaq nx9005 (if that makes a difference). The
system goes ahead and prints my page but I want the error
to stop showing up. Any ideas on how to get rid of it?

Just a shot in the dark. Check the properties of the
printer and see whether the number of megs of memory
showing for the printer do, indeed, match what you've
installed. Adjust as appropriate.
